Yellow Moon Over Village (SOLD)381 viewsYellow Moon Over Village is a Mi'kmaq "Starry, Starry Night". I remember as a child, going to midnight mass and looking for the star o Bethlehem. Now I look at the sky the way a traditionalist sees it. As I research the Mi'kmaq view of the stars, these stars were the markers by which the creator would send you to this world, and when you cross over, you follow the very same stars to go back home to the Creator.

Caribou Under Silver Moon (SOLD)298 viewsThis painting came from thinking obut the Debert campsite, which is said to be between ten and twelve thousand years old. This land was said to be savannah land, very lush, similar to Africa, filled with animals of all descriptions. Those animals supported this camp which was said to be sixty square acres. There are three caribou grazing on this plain. The silver moon represents the fact that in ten thousand years, there have been one hundred and thirty thousand moons.
